CRH (CRH) exhibited short-term weakness, closing down 1.39% and underperforming the broader market, despite a strong trailing one-month gain of 4.88% that surpassed both the S&P 500 and the Construction sector. The market is pricing in mixed expectations for the company's upcoming earnings release on August 6, 2025. Consensus estimates project a 6.99% year-over-year increase in quarterly revenue to $10.33 billion, but also a slight 0.54% decline in EPS to $1.84, suggesting potential margin compression. This near-term concern is reflected in the 2.06% downward revision of the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ate over the past month, contributing to its current #3 (Hold) rating. However, the full-year outlook remains positive, with analysts forecasting 4.64% earnings growth and 7.14% revenue growth. On a valuation basis, CRH appears attractive, trading at a Forward P/E of 16.69 and a PEG ratio of 1.46, both of which represent a discount to their respective industry averages of 18.29 and 1.95. This is further supported by the company's position within a strongly-ranked industry (top 28%), indicating a favorable sector backdrop.
